Ok, I have got the fan mod figured out, But it is very different then my origianal plans. Looking further into the fuse box and relay I have come to find that there is no wires going to the switch side of this relay. The PCM that controls this function is mounted directly to the fuse/relay box that feeds a circuit board.
I dont like testing PCM inputs and I dont want to run the switch through the PCM for fear of back feeding into it. So I found a very simple solution but in my mind it's a slight short cut. But it will work perfect.
We tap a wire to the switched(-) side of the removed relay,replace the relay and hook the wire to a grounded switch. Only problem is you will have a wire comming out of the top of your fuse box. But also makes it easy for removal on dealer visits If you all are ok with that i will carry on and document the install on the SRT .mac site of mine.
p.s. I feel this is the quickest, cheapest, safest, way. 0 cut factory wires, no 12V supply. Simple simple simple

Yes very different. The abs controls the Traction control and by removing the power to the Module you have NO TC and NO ABS.
Be careful using the factory switch. Its not an on/off switch its a momentary switch, I think, So you would have to hold it down while driving to shut it off or turn it on. Not a good option while spinning your tires
Engine running, throws DTC P0480 Fan 1 low speed control malfunction. I could not reset this with engine running, had to shut off to reset w/Dashhawk, which resets I/M monitor drive cycle. I do not want to do this all the time, since the EVAP I/M monitor takes so long to reset and I do not want to throw P1000 codes during state inspection (drive cycle incomplete) for Pennsylvania, where you fail on P1000 (unless <5K miles since last inspection)
For now, will only run fans w/key OFF to cool radiator and monitor batt voltage w/Dashhawk so i don't run it down at track.
